The Importance of the Code of Professional Conduct
“The Code or Professional Conduct doesn’t apply to me as a student…right?! How about as a volunteer?” Good questions! In this workshop we will analyze the CPC and discuss its practical applications as a student and as a professional interpreter. We will look at the individual tenets of the CPC and then we will apply those to specific situation in a small group setting.

Ethics in Religious Settings
“Does being a volunteer interpreter at my church make me immune to ethical standards?” “Is it okay that tell other people about my Deaf client’s prayer requests to have others pray too?” In this workshop, we will take a look at the RID-NAD Code of Professional Conduct and its practical applications in religious settings. The line between interpreter and church member can be difficult to determine at times and we will explore that boundary. We will look at the individual tenets of the CPC and then we will apply those to specific situation in a small group setting.
Ethics in Education
So...a 2nd grade Deaf student just cussed his teacher out in front of the class. A high school history teacher wants to talk to you about the Deaf student in front of her but does not want you to interpret what is being said. A college professor asks you to run copies of the lecture right before class because she is answering homework questions. WHAT DO YOU DO??!! We will take an indepth look at the Code of Professional Conduct as well as laws where they apply to discuss possible courses of action in educational scenarios.
Ethics in Medical Settings
“What do I do if I disagree with the treatment proposed for a patient?” “What if I know the patient is lying about their medical history and it could cause them harm?” In this workshop, we will take a look at the RID-NAD Code of Professional Conduct and its practical applications in medical settings. We will look at the individual tenets of the CPC and then we will apply those to specific situation in a small group setting.
